Abstract
Foundations are a crucial part of bridge construction because foundations support loads and transfer them to solid ground. The selection of foundation type must be adapted to soil conditions and the loads it will bear. In the construction project of the Pundang Bridge STA 38+195 on the Solo–Jogja–NYIA Toll Road, bored pile foundations were used. In this study, modifications to the bored pile foundations will be performed by enlarging the pile base. This research analyzes bearing capacity using the Nakazawa method (2000) and settlement using the Vessic method (1977), utilizing the ALL PILE software for bored pile foundations with a diameter of 0.8 meters and an enlarged pile tip diameter of 1.85 meters, while the existing bored pile foundation uses a diameter of 1 meter. In modifying bored pile foundations with enlargement at the pile tip, the drilling method is also considered, taking into account soil displacement during the drilling process. The drilling method used is the wet method with the use of casing and slurry. This research is expected to be more efficient and effective in terms of the number of foundation piles used in the construction site. The results of this study show that the bearing capacity before modification was 466.31 tons at abutment 1 and 457 tons at abutment 2. Meanwhile, after modification, the bearing capacity was 689.95 tons at abutment 1 and 705.72 tons at abutment 2. The modification of bored pile foundations with enlargement at the pile tip resulted in an increase in pile bearing capacity of 48% at abutment 1 and 54% at abutment 2. The settlement of the foundation after modification using the ALL PILE software was found to be 1.14 cm at abutment 1 and 1.29 cm at abutment 2.
